项目摘要
1. It has been shown that the hypervariable region of flagellin of
strains of Salmonella (potentially useful as typhoid vaccines) is a
suitable locus for insertion of DNA coding for epitopes which are of
interest as potentially effective immunogens for diseases other than
salmonellosis. A nonapeptide which represents aa163-171 of Il-1 beta has
been shown to be immunoenhancing. We shall test whether the expression
of this nonapeptide enhances immune response to determinants which are
juxtaposed to, near or spatially removed from this nonapeptide when it is
inserted in the hypervariable region of vaccine strains of Salmonella.
2. Many polysaccharide antigens are considered to bc T independent in the
sense that response to them does not require T cell help; anamnestic
responses are not elicited and the immunoglobulin isotype response is
restricted with such antigens. We propose to test a method to convert
oligosaccharide determinants of such antigens to T dependence enabling
both the elicitation of memory and unrestricted class switching.
Furthermore, the process would make it possible to have such antigens
expressed as peptide surrogates as piggy-back antigens in the
hypervariable region of flagellin as in 1. A monoclonal anti Salmonella
Vi will be used to screen a random peptide library for adventitious
cross-reactive peptides which will be back-translated to DNA, and
inserted for expression in the hypervariable region of flagellin. The
essential hypothesis is that cross-reactivity as recognized in reaction
will bc matched by cross-reactivity in induction of immune response.
Specifically this might greatly enhance the utility of the typhoid
vaccines being tested since they do not at present elicit anti-Vi.
